What Makes a Good Quote for Brother and Sister Tattoos?

The ideal quote for brother and sister tattoos should resonate deeply with both individuals. It should capture the essence of your unique relationship, reflecting shared memories, inside jokes, or mutual values. Consider the following factors:

  • Personal Meaning: The quote should hold significant personal meaning for both of you, not just a generic sentiment about sibling love.
  • Length and Style: Shorter quotes are generally easier to incorporate into a tattoo design, but longer, more evocative phrases can also work beautifully depending on the font and style.
  • Font and Style: The font choice significantly impacts the overall look and feel of the tattoo. Consider fonts that complement your personalities and the style of the tattoo art.
  • Placement: The placement of the tattoo will also influence your quote choice. A small quote might be perfect for a wrist or finger, while a larger quote could adorn the forearm or back.

Meaningful Quotes for Brother and Sister Tattoos

Here are some ideas, categorized for easier browsing, encompassing various aspects of sibling relationships:

Quotes Emphasizing Unbreakable Bonds:

  • "Blood is thicker than water." A classic choice emphasizing the enduring nature of family ties.
  • "A brother is a friend given by God." A heartfelt sentiment expressing gratitude for the sibling bond. This can be easily adapted to include sisters.
  • "Through thick and thin, always." This emphasizes unwavering support throughout life's journey.
  • "My brother, my protector, my friend." (Adaptable for sisters). A direct and emotive statement.

Quotes Highlighting Shared Memories and Inside Jokes:

  • (Personalized Quote): Create a quote based on a shared inside joke or a special memory. This adds a unique and deeply personal touch.
  • "We did it our way." This works well if you've forged your own path together.

Quotes About Support and Love:

  • "My sister, my rock." (Adaptable for brothers). Highlights the unwavering support provided.
  • "You're my favorite person I didn't choose." A playful yet affectionate statement.
  • "Best friends by blood, sisters by heart." (Adaptable for brothers). Emphasizes the strong friendship at the core.

Quotes That Are Short and Sweet:

  • "Sisterhood." Simple, elegant, and powerful. (Adaptable for brotherhood).
  • "Family." A universal symbol of love and belonging.
  • "Forever." A timeless declaration of enduring love.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Where should I get my brother and sister tattoo?

The best placement depends on your preferences and the size of the quote. Popular spots include the wrist, forearm, ribcage, shoulder, and back. Consider the visibility and pain tolerance of each location.

What if my brother/sister doesn't want a matching tattoo?

Complementary tattoos offer a beautiful alternative. You could each choose a quote related to your shared bond, but with different fonts, styles, or artistic elements. Alternatively, you could choose a single element (like a symbol) and personalize its design.

How can I make my brother/sister tattoo unique?

Personalization is key! Incorporate meaningful dates, initials, or small symbols that hold significance for your relationship. Adding artistic flourishes like watercolor effects, geometric designs, or personalized illustrations can make it truly one-of-a-kind.

What style of font should I choose?

The font should complement the overall aesthetic of the tattoo and your personal styles. Script fonts offer a delicate and flowing look, while bolder fonts can create a more striking visual impact.

How do I find a good tattoo artist?

Research tattoo artists in your area who specialize in lettering and the style you prefer. Look at their portfolios, read online reviews, and consider meeting with several artists before making a decision.
